1. Strategic Rebrand to heyAura (2 April 2026)

Overview: The AdEx Network, originally a decentralized advertising protocol, announced a complete rebrand to heyAura. The company is pivoting its focus to developing an autonomous AI assistant embedded directly within Web3 wallets. This shift aims to simplify user interaction with complex on-chain environments by enabling natural language commands for actions like DeFi yield harvesting and transaction batching. The first deep integration is planned with Ambire Wallet. 1. Full Rebrand to heyAura (2 April 2026)

Overview: The company completed a fundamental strategic shift on 2 April 2026, rebranding from AdEx to heyAura (CoinMarketCap). This move transitions its focus from decentralized advertising infrastructure to building an autonomous AI assistant that lives inside Web3 wallets. The assistant allows users to execute complex on-chain actions—like finding DeFi yield, swapping assets, or revoking approvals—using natural language. The first deep integration is planned for Ambire Wallet, with support for other wallets and third-party builders to follow.

2. Identity Partnership with Billions Network (2026)

Overview: Announced on 20 April 2026, heyAura is partnering with Billions Network to integrate verifiable identity into its AI agent framework (heyAura). This collaboration aims to solve the trust and security challenges that arise when autonomous agents interact with real user assets, ensuring that actions are traceable and accountable.

3. Local AI Model for Enhanced Privacy (2026)

Overview: A core development focus is creating a version of heyAura's AI that can run locally on a user's device (heyAura). This design prioritizes privacy by ensuring sensitive wallet data and transaction history never leave the user's control, while still providing personalized insights and automation.

2. AURA Open-Source API Launch (16 September 2025)

Overview: This update opened the AURA framework to developers, providing modular tools to build AI-driven Web3 applications. It turns AURA from a closed product into a platform for ecosystem growth.

The API allows developers to create applications that analyze on-chain data, user activity, and market trends to generate personalized DeFi strategies. It features Model Context Protocol (MCP) compatibility for easy integration with AI platforms like Claude and ChatGPT.

3. CoinGecko MCP Data Integration (August 2025)

Overview: This technical integration connected AURA to CoinGecko's on-chain data feed, dramatically improving the AI agent's access to real-time market information for over 9 million tokens.

The integration via CoinGecko's Model Context Protocol (MCP) provides trustless, verifiable data, enabling AURA to deliver faster and more accurate strategy recommendations. This backend upgrade is crucial for the agent's autonomy and reliability.

4. AURA Demo Launch & Core Upgrades (May–August 2025)

Overview: The initial public demo release marked the first major code deployment of the AURA AI agent, allowing users to input a wallet address for personalized strategy analysis.

Subsequent updates included automated LLM testing for better reliability, upgraded prompt engineering, and added support for BNB Smart Chain and Mantle networks. An admin panel was also developed for internal testing and performance tracking.
